Bitcoin/US Dollar Elliott Wave technical analysis [Video]

Elliott Wave Analysis TradingLounge Daily Chart, 14 February 24, 

Bitcoin/U.S. dollar(BTCUSD).

BTC/USD Elliott Wave technical analysis

Function: Follow Trend.

Mode: Motive.

Structure: Impulse.

Position: Wave V.

Direction Next higher Degrees: Wave (III).

Wave Cancel invalid level: 31046.25.

Details: The five-wave increase in wave (III).

Bitcoin/ U.S. dollar(BTCUSD)Trading Strategy:

Wave II correction appears to be over at the 81.485 level and the price is likely to be bullish again. We are looking at a five-wave increase. to support this idea.

Bitcoin/U.S. dollar(BTCUSD)Technical Indicators: The price is above the MA200 indicating an Uptrend, Wave Oscillators a bullish Momentum.
